18 connections·19 entities in this video→Concerns Over DOGE and Government Data Access
- 🎯 Transparency is the core issue regarding the actions of the Trump Administration and DOGE (an entity seemingly related to Elon Musk).
- ⚠️ The American people are reportedly fed up with DOGE assessing government payment systems and taxpayer data.
- 📬 Treasury and DOGE have allegedly refused to answer letters, calls, and requests for information, prompting calls for them to testify before the committee.
Elon Musk's Conflicts of Interest
- 💰 Elon Musk receives billions in government contracts and has access to sensitive taxpayer data.
- 🧐 Concerns are raised about Musk not filing financial disclosures, disclosing conflicts of interest, or giving up control of companies receiving government funds.
- 📈 There are fears that this information could be used for personal gain, with Musk allegedly using the administration for his own benefit.
Allegations of Misuse of Power
- 🔍 DOGE has reportedly targeted numerous government agencies, including the Department of Labor, CFPB, USAID, and the SEC, many of which are investigating Musk or his businesses.
- 🚫 The claim is made that DOGE is not focused on waste, fraud, and abuse, evidenced by the firing of inspectors general.
- 🏛️ Instead, the focus is allegedly on passing bills that could negatively impact programs like Medicaid and extend tax cuts to the top 1%.
Republican Colleagues and Constituent Engagement
- 🗣️ Republican colleagues are accused of being tired of hearing from constituents concerned about Elon Musk and the Trump Administration.
- 🚫 They are reportedly refusing to call the secretary and Mr. Musk before the committee and are telling members to stop holding town hall meetings.
- 📉 This lack of engagement is seen as unprecedented and a refusal to meet with constituents concerned about these issues.
Call for Action and Transparency
- 📢 Rep. Thompson urges Republican colleagues to vote for a resolution demanding answers from the administration.
- 🗳️ The American people voted for change, not chaos, and did not vote to end Medicaid, fire veterans, or reduce Social Security.
- ✅ The resolution aims to achieve disclosure, transparency, and witness testimony to address constituent concerns.
